"Maty"
stepped down as head coach of the Shockers
following a 14-1 season in 2007 and now
looks to step back on the playing field for
one last hurrah. One of the nastiest
middle linebackers on the legendary Auburn
Panthers team which had an unbeaten streak
of 57 games in the mid 1980's, Steve was
inducted into the MLFN Hall of Fame in 2006
following a near 20-year career as a player
and assistant coach before taking the head
job with the Shockers. Holder of one
of the best won-loss records in the
northwest (24-2), Steve will look to
continue those winning ways once again from
under a helmet.
